Abstract
This paper presents a new application of the iterative reweighted least squared error algorithm to obtain a constrained least squares approximation for designing a linear phase FIR filter. A new method is given which has good initial convergence coupled with quadratic final convergence. We compare two methods of using the IRLS approach to the CLS problem.
